2019 has barely started, and we've already suffered a great loss: A "69" mile marker is gone forever, and will not be replaced.

The Washington Department of Transportation is sick and tired of people stealing the marker (notably known as the ~sex number~) so it's replacing the highway sign with one that says "68.9." 

"Thieves show no signs of slowing down," a local CBS station reported. Watch the mildly painful banter between the two anchors as they debate the accuracy of the sign without cracking up over its reference to a sex position.  Read more...
